I made 5 cups of granola that my family eats in ⅗ cup servings. Will there be more than 5 servings?

Respuesta :

rjy1204 rjy1204
  • 21-03-2020

Answer:yes there will be more than 5 servings

Step-by-step explanation:you have five cups and each serving is 3/5 cup so you multiply 5 by the denominator to get 25 and then divide that by 3 to get the amout of servings witch is 8.33
